How Far From Fairhope to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Fairhope to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Fairhope and extending to:

  • Uniontown, which is the Seat of Fayette County, lies 16 miles [25.7 km]<1> to the south southeast. If you could walk a straight line from Fairhope to Uniontown, with an average speed<4>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take most of a day to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take five to six hours.
  • Harrisburg, which is the State Capital of Pennsylvania, lies 156 miles [251.1 km] to the east (E).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take less than three hours, a buggy would take 6 days and walking would take 9 days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 171 miles [275.2 km] to the east southeast (ESE). Driving would take about three hours, a buggy would take 7 days and walking would take 10 days.

<5>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Fairhope to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
